Gary Goferit, Ph.D.: The primary ethical issue here is the abuse of power and trust. As a professor, Goferit is in a position of authority and trust over his students. By engaging in sexual relationships with his students, he is exploiting this power dynamic, which is a clear violation of professional ethics. This is especially true if the relationships were not consensual or if they involved coercion or manipulation. Additionally, if Goferit was married at the time of the affairs, this would also raise ethical issues related to fidelity and honesty in personal relationships.

Paula Jettison and other students: The ethical issues here relate to the right to safety, respect, and dignity. If Jettison and the other students were sexually harassed or exploited, their rights were violated. It's also important to consider the ethical implications of their decision to come forward. They have a right to seek justice and to protect others from similar harm. However, they also have a responsibility to be truthful and fair in their accusations.

Dr. Goferit's wife: The ethical issues here relate to honesty, fidelity, and respect in personal relationships. If Goferit was unfaithful to his wife, he violated these ethical principles. His wife also has a right to know about his behavior and to make decisions about their relationship based on this information.
